The Lifemusic™ method uses direct access musical improvisation to enhance well-being and nurture good relationships. It is an invaluable tool in healthcare and community settings, for music therapists, in music healing and also in corporate settings where it has been found to be very useful in team building.
The training programme has already produced a team of 45 practitioners who are now using the Lifemusic method to varying degrees in their lives and in their work. This includes work with families and children, neurological-rehab, older people, young people, mental health, cancer care, migrant working communities, teams in business environments as well as people simply meeting up to “connect to time”. You do not need to be a trained musician to undertake the training, current practitioners include both trained musicians and other professionals.
